Train Options from Paris to Guingamp
Type | company | departure station | arrival station | departure time | arrival time | Frequency | Duration | Price Range | layover city |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Direct | TGV inOui | Paris Montparnasse 1 Et 2, Paris | Guingamp, Guingamp | 06:30, 10:30, 14:30, 18:30 | 09:09, 13:09, 17:09, 21:09 | Every 4 hours | 2h 39m | € 82-183 | |
Connecting | TGV inOui | Paris Montparnasse 1 Et 2, Paris | Guingamp, Guingamp | 07:15, 11:15 | 10:50, 14:50 | Twice daily | 3h 35m | € 90-190 | Rennes |
Connecting | Intercités | Paris Montparnasse 1 Et 2, Paris | Guingamp, Guingamp | 08:45, 15:45 | 12:08, 19:08 | Twice daily | 3h 23m | € 75-150 | Quimper |

Main Train Stations in Paris
Gare Montparnasse
facilities
- Restrooms
- Waiting areas with seating
- Ticket counters and self-service kiosks
- Luggage storage lockers
- Free Wi-Fi
- Food and beverage options (cafés, vending machines)
- ATMs and currency exchange services
- Accessibility features (ramps, elevators)
Transportation Links
- Public transportation options: Metro Line 6, Metro Line 4, Tramway T3
- Taxi and rideshare services available at designated drop-off points
- Parking facilities for private vehicles with short-term and long-term options
- Arrive at least 30 minutes before departure to navigate the station and find your platform.
- Be prepared for security checks and ticket validation.
- Avoid peak hours from 8 AM to 9 AM and 5 PM to 6 PM for less crowding.
- Explore nearby Montparnasse district for quick dining options if time permits.
Main Train Stations in Guingamp
Gare de Guingamp
facilities
- Restrooms
- Waiting areas with seating
- Ticket counters
- Luggage storage
- Limited food and beverage options
- ATMs available
Transportation Links
- Local public buses connect to different parts of Guingamp
- Taxi services available at the station's entrance
- Bicycle parking is also available for cyclists
- Plan to arrive 10-15 minutes early to allow for disembarkation and gathering belonging.
- Check for any potential local events that might affect transportation options upon arrival.
- The station is generally less crowded, but services may have limited hours.
- Take a stroll into town to discover charming shops and eateries nearby.
